My Non Ecc Memory Won't Work On My Asus H81m-k Motherboard But Will On Others I Have?

    I have a few non ecc memory sticks ranging from 4gb (2x2gb) 1066MHz to 8gb (2x4gb) 1600MHz and even 16gb (2X16gb):

    4gb (2x2gb): Micron 2GB DDR3 1060MHz Desktop Memory MT16JTF25664AZ-1G1F1
    8gb (2x4gb): Crucial Sport Ballistix DDR3 1600MHz desktop memory BLS2KIT4G3D1609DS1S00
    16gb (2x8gb): Kingston HyperX Genisis DDR3 1600MHz KHX18C10K2/16

    When I tried the above memory in my Asus H81M-K build DIMM A1 slot didn't see show any ram (as though it was empty). The DIMM B1 did show ram and allowed the computer to boot up. When I tried ram in just the DIMM A1 slot the computer won't boot as though there was no ram.

    I sent the motherboard back to asus with an RMA and got it back with a statement the tech couldn't duplicate the symptom. When I called they asked me if any of the memory I tried was on the asus qauality vendors list. Well, non of the above ones were.

    I've tried these same memory sticks in the following motherboards and they worked fine.
    Gigabyte LGA 1156g GA-H55M-S2V rev. 1.3 motherboard
    Asus B85M-E motherboard
    Gigabyte H81M-DS2V

    I finally was able to try the following memory which is on the Asus Quality Vendors List
    8gb (2x4gb): G.Skill TridentX series DDR3 2400MHz F3-2400C10D-8GTX
    I still had the same problem with DIMM A1 slot not showing any memory.

    I've since got another RMA and have sent it back explaining that this time I did try memory from their QVL list and still had the same issue. Why the heck does the Asus H81M-K motherboard seem so fickle with memory compatibility? What on a motherboard controls what non ecc memory will work with it.

    I know it's wordy, but I wanted to explain my dilemma and try to understand more about memory issues. Thanks, Mcduke
